Banana-Caramel Pie
- Yield 8 servings
This pie will be the sweet treat you can't resist.
Ingredients
- 10 candy caramels
- 2 cups milk
- 1/3 cup flour
- 1/3 cup sugar
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 3 slightly beaten egg yolks
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
- 2 bananas
- 1 baked pie shell
- 1 cup heavy cream, whipped
Instructions
- Melt caramels in milk over low heat. Combine flour, sugar and salt in double boiler. Add caramel-milk mixture and cook over water until thick, stirring constantly. Add beaten egg yolks to which a little hot mixture has been added. Cook 5 minutes longer, stirring. Remove from heat. Add vanilla, cover and chill.
- Arrange 2 sliced bananas on bakied pie shell. Cover with filling. Top with whipped cream.
